ToggleNeuroWatt, an interesting startup focused on AI infrastructure, has recently gained acceptance into both the Plug and Play and XDC Network accelerator programs. This signals a significant push toward blending artificial intelligence with decentralized finance (DeFi). Their primary project, the AIWATT protocol, aims to tackle the funding challenges of AI development and introduce innovative real-world asset (RWA) applications to the DeFi space. This is more than just a news blip; it’s a potential glimpse into how future technologies will support each other.
At its core, NeuroWatt is working on two major problems. First, AI development is notoriously expensive, requiring significant investment in computing power, data storage, and skilled personnel. Second, the DeFi world is constantly searching for reliable and stable assets to back its complex financial instruments. NeuroWatt aims to bridge these needs. The AIWATT protocol is designed to create a framework where AI infrastructure can be financed through DeFi mechanisms, essentially allowing AI assets to be used as collateral or investment vehicles within the decentralized finance ecosystem. This could mean new opportunities for investors and developers alike.
The selection of NeuroWatt into the Plug and Play and XDC Network accelerators is strategically important. Plug and Play is known for its extensive network and history of supporting innovative startups, particularly in the fintech and blockchain areas. This provides NeuroWatt with access to potential investors, mentors, and partnership opportunities. The XDC Network, on the other hand, offers a robust blockchain platform designed for enterprise use, with a focus on real-world applications. Its hybrid architecture, combining public and private blockchain features, makes it suitable for handling sensitive data and regulatory requirements, which are critical for AI and financial applications. Together, these accelerators offer NeuroWatt a blend of business development and technological support. This is a smart move that could dramatically speed up their progress.
The concept of real-world assets in DeFi is not new, but it is gaining traction. RWAs refer to tangible assets like real estate, commodities, and even infrastructure being tokenized and used within DeFi protocols. NeuroWatt’s approach involves tokenizing AI infrastructure, essentially turning computing power and data storage into tradable assets. This has the potential to unlock liquidity for AI developers, allowing them to raise capital more easily. It also offers DeFi investors access to a new asset class that is tied to the growth of the AI industry. However, challenges remain in terms of valuation, regulation, and the practicalities of managing these complex assets on a blockchain. Getting this right will be crucial for NeuroWatt’s success and the broader adoption of RWAs in DeFi.
Despite the promising outlook, NeuroWatt faces significant hurdles. The regulatory landscape for both AI and DeFi is constantly evolving, and navigating these complexities will be crucial. Security is also a paramount concern, as the intersection of AI and finance creates new attack vectors. Furthermore, the technical challenges of integrating AI infrastructure with blockchain technology are substantial. Ensuring scalability, interoperability, and data privacy will require significant engineering effort. However, if NeuroWatt can overcome these challenges, the opportunities are immense. The potential to democratize access to AI infrastructure, create new investment opportunities, and drive innovation in both the AI and DeFi sectors is substantial.
NeuroWatt’s endeavor suggests a future where AI and DeFi are not separate entities but work together. The AIWATT protocol represents a step toward creating a symbiotic relationship where DeFi provides the financial fuel for AI development, and AI enhances the capabilities and efficiency of DeFi platforms. This is not just about creating new financial products; it’s about building a more resilient and innovative ecosystem. Whether NeuroWatt will succeed remains to be seen, but their journey highlights the transformative potential of combining these two powerful technologies. The next few years will be critical as they move from concept to implementation, and the industry will be watching closely.
